I cut most of your message to remark on the one section that caught my
eye most. You luck person you. Having a creek run through your property
with lots of shade trees. Should make for absolute heaven this summer. If I
had the property I would be purchasing plants and sowing seeds of all kinds
of Primula to plant along the moist places in drifts. Then for larger
plants to break up the drifts, Goats Beard, Bugbanes, Turtlehead. Lots of
moisture loving Iris and tall lilies.
